Beschreibung:

LAWRENCE, John (1753-1839)]. British Field Sports; embracing Practical Instructions in Shooting - Hunting - Coursing...Fishing, &c...by William Henry Scott [pseud.] . London: Sherwood, Neely and Jones, 1818. 12 original parts, 8° (251 x 155mm). 34 engraved plates by Tookey, Davenport and others after Reinagle, Barrenger and others, wood-engraved illustrations in the text, advertisement leaf in parts I & IV, 2 advertisement leaves in part XI and 4 advertisement leaves in parts VIII & IX, advertisement slip in parts V & XI. (Some light foxing and soiling.) Original wrappers with wood-engraved vignette on front wrapper, a different one on part XII (lacks wrappers in part IV, others mostly a little torn and soiled), green cloth folder, in a red straight-grained morocco pull-off box. Provenance : C.F.G.R. Schwerdt (bookplate; his sale, 10 July 1939, lot 1657). SCHWERDT COPY OF THE FIRST EDITION and a rare copy in the original wrappers, complete with the 8pp. poem The Sportsman's Progress loosely inserted in part 1. Schwerdt I, p.305 'incomplete without "The Sportsman's Progress," which is generally missing. [LAWRENCE, John]. British Field Sports . London: Sherwood, Neely and Jones, 1820. 8° (225 x 135mm). 34 engraved plates, pictorial half-title. (Some foxing and offsetting.) Original pictorial boards, uncut (somewhat worn), blue cloth folder and slipcase. Provenance : John Greaves (19th-century armorial stamp on an endpaper) - Myles C. Radford (early 20th-century armorial bookplate). Second edition, The design on the half-title and on the front board are taken from two of the original wrappers of the first edition. (2)
